Leaverne Cyrus Weaver 1914 - 1970

Leaverne Cyrus Weaver was born on December 11, 1914, and died at age 55 years old on June 1, 1970. Leaverne Weaver was buried at Rock Island National Cemetery Section J Site 52 Bldg 118 - Rock Island Arsenal, in Rock Island, Il. Did you know?
In 1914, in the year that Leaverne Cyrus Weaver was born, President Woodrow Wilson signed a proclamation designating Mother's Day, the second Sunday in May, as a national holiday to honor mothers. Anna Jarvis had championed a Mother's Day for years but Congress had joked a few years earlier that then they would have to proclaim a "Mother-in-law's Day" as well.
